X-Git-Url: https://git.m6w6.name/?a=blobdiff_plain;f=docs%2Fmemcached_servers.pod;h=125e1f4b1ba169c33d6fa3c7df885fd3fe2305f9;hb=8d2e59120724923d1ebe75112d73ef03181e0e67;hp=d1a61cd605493d4fb5ccffa48661d5fdf0a4f5f0;hpb=8a5081c5ed9c33b1d6d5f070ba97b2b21b7a0da8;p=awesomized%2Flibmemcached diff --git a/docs/memcached_servers.pod b/docs/memcached_servers.pod old mode 100755 new mode 100644 index d1a61cd6..125e1f4b --- a/docs/memcached_servers.pod +++ b/docs/memcached_servers.pod @@ -1,6 +1,6 @@ =head1 NAME -memcached_server_count, memcached_server_list, memcached_server_add, memcached_server_push +memcached_server_count, memcached_server_list, memcached_server_add, memcached_server_push - Manage server list =head1 LIBRARY @@ -17,12 +17,17 @@ C Client Library for memcached (libmemcached, -lmemcached) memcached_return memcached_server_add (memcached_st *ptr, - char *hostname, + const char *hostname, + unsigned int port); + + memcached_return + memcached_server_add_udp (memcached_st *ptr, + const char *hostname, unsigned int port); memcached_return memcached_server_add_unix_socket (memcached_st *ptr, - char *socket); + const char *socket); memcached_return memcached_server_push (memcached_st *ptr, @@ -47,9 +52,17 @@ memcached_server_list() is used to provide an array of all defined hosts. You are responsible for freeing this list (aka it is not a pointer to the currently used structure). -memcached_server_add() pushes a single server into the C +memcached_server_add() pushes a single TCP server into the C +structure. This server will be placed at the end. Duplicate servers are +allowed, so duplication is not checked. Executing this function with the +C behavior set will result in a +C. + +memcached_server_add_udp() pushes a single UDP server into the C structure. This server will be placed at the end. Duplicate servers are -allowed, so duplication is not checked. +allowed, so duplication is not checked. Executing this function with out +setting the C behavior will result in a +C. memcached_server_add_unix_socket() pushes a single UNIX socket into the C structure. This UNIX socket will be placed at the end.